The Board of Directors of American Shared Hospital Services announced the following realignment of management duties, effective October 1, 2020. Craig K. Tagawa will assume the title of President, in addition to his current positions as Chief Operating and Financial Officer and Assistant Secretary. Ernest R. Bates will be promoted to Senior Vice President and will lead International Operations in addition to his current Sales and Business Development duties. Alexis Wallace, currently the Company’s Controller, will become Chief Accounting Officer. Ernest A. American Shared Hospital Services is a provider of financial and turnkey solutions to cancer treatment centers, hospitals, and large cancer networks worldwide. Its products include MR Guided Radiation Therapy Linacs, Advanced Linear Accelerators, Proton Beam Therapy systems, Brachytherapy systems, and through its GK Financing partnership with Elekta, the Leksell Gamma Knife product and services. PBRT is an alternative to traditional external beam, photon-based radiation delivered by linear accelerators. PBRT treats prostate, brain, spine, head and neck, lung, breast, gastrointestinal tract and pediatric tumors. The Gamma Knife treats selected malignant and benign brain tumors, arteriovenous malformations, and functional disorders including trigeminal neuralgia (facial pain). It typically provides the equipment and planning, installation, reimbursement and marketing support services. It also operates three fully functional turn-key radiation therapy cancer centers in Rhode Island.
